
Creamy Goat Cheese Pasta with Spinach and Roasted Mushrooms
BARS = SHARE OF RECIPE CALORIES · RINGS = FDA DV
Creamy goat cheese pasta with roasted mushrooms and fresh spinach. A meatless meal that's easy and regular enough for weeknight dinners, with earthy flavors and rich creaminess.

Ingredients
- 1 8 ounce package Crimini mushrooms, stems removed and cut in half
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 1 tablespoon balsamic vinegar
- 1 tablespoon minced garlic
- Salt and black pepper (to taste)
- 1 lb pasta (we used Rotini)
- 4 cups spinach (coarsely chopped)
- 6 ounces goat cheese (crumbled)
- 1/3 cup freshly chopped basil
